In Idaho, 175 colleges are offering Clinical/Medical Laboratory Science/Research and Allied Professions programsin both undergraduate and graduate levels. The 2024 average undergraduate tuition & fees of the Clinical/Medical Laboratory Science/Research and Allied Professions program is $8,309 for state residents and $24,622 for out-of-state students.
114 schools offer clinical-medical-laboratory-science-research-and-allied-professions vocational programs. The average vocational program's tuition at the schools is $16,097.
46 Idaho graduate schools offer the Clinical/Medical Laboratory Science/Research and Allied Professions programs and the average graduate tuition & fees is $10,993 for state residents and $27,052 for out-of-state students.

Idaho Tuition for Clinical/Medical Laboratory Science/Research and Allied Professions

175 Idaho colleges have the Clinical/Medical Laboratory Science/Research and Allied Professions program. By school type, there are 129 public and 46 private schools offering Clinical/Medical Laboratory Science/Research and Allied Professions program.
50 schools offer the Clinical/Medical Laboratory Science/Research and Allied Professions program granting BS degrees in undergraduate schools. The average tuition & fees for BS Clinical/Medical Laboratory Science/Research and Allied Professions program is $8,309 for state residents and $24,622 for out-of-state students for the academic year 2023-2024.
Of the 175 colleges, 28 schools offer online degree and/or courses for Clinical/Medical Laboratory Science/Research and Allied Professions program.
